When your grass cutting machine refuses to start, performing a few preliminary checks can often resolve the issue. These steps will help you identify and address common problems effectively.
Fuel quality plays a critical role in starting your machine. Follow these steps to ensure the fuel system is in good condition:
Ensure the fuel tank is filled with fresh gasoline
Old or stale fuel can prevent the engine from starting. If the machine has been sitting unused for over 30 days, drain the old fuel and refill the tank with fresh gasoline. Adding a fuel stabilizer during storage can help maintain fuel quality.
Verify that the fuel type matches the machine’s requirements
Always check the owner’s manual for the recommended fuel type. Many machines require higher-octane gasoline. Using regular 87 octane gas, if not recommended, can lead to startup issues. Ensuring the correct fuel type will improve engine performance and reliability.
Oil is essential for the smooth operation of your grass cutting machine. Low or contaminated oil can cause the engine to malfunction. Here’s what you need to do:
Check the oil level using the dipstick
Remove the dipstick, wipe it clean, and reinsert it to check the oil level. If the oil level is low, add the appropriate type of oil as specified in the manual.
Ensure the oil is clean and not contaminated
Dirty or contaminated oil can harm the engine. If the oil appears dark or gritty, replace it immediately. For machines requiring a gas-oil mixture, ensure you add the correct amount of oil to the fuel.
The spark plug is a vital component for starting the engine. A faulty spark plug can disrupt the ignition process. Take these steps to inspect and maintain it:
Remove the spark plug and inspect for dirt, damage, or wear
Disconnect the spark plug wire and use a wrench to remove the plug. Look for signs of carbon buildup, cracks, or corrosion. A damaged spark plug will need replacement.
Clean or replace the spark plug if needed
If the spark plug is dirty but still functional, clean it with a wire brush to remove carbon deposits. Check the gap setting using a spark plug gap tool and adjust it according to the manual. Replace the spark plug if it shows severe wear or has been used for over 100 hours.
Pro Tip: Regularly inspect and replace the spark plug annually to ensure optimal performance. A well-maintained spark plug ensures the engine receives the proper spark to ignite the fuel.

When your grass cutting machine struggles to start, the air and fuel systems often hold the key to resolving the issue. Proper airflow and fuel delivery are essential for engine performance. Follow these steps to inspect and maintain these critical components.
A clean air filter ensures proper airflow to the engine. Over time, dirt and debris can clog the filter, restricting airflow and making it difficult for the engine to start. Here’s how you can address this:
Remove the air filter and check for dirt or clogs
Open the air filter housing as per the manufacturer’s instructions. Take out the filter and inspect it for dust, grass clippings, or other debris. A clogged filter can suffocate the engine, preventing it from starting.
Wash or replace the air filter as per the manufacturer’s instructions
If the filter is washable, rinse it with warm water and mild detergent. Allow it to dry completely before reinstalling. For paper filters or heavily clogged ones, replace them with a new filter. Regular cleaning or replacement keeps the engine running smoothly and extends its lifespan.
Tip: Clean the air filter after every 25 hours of use or more frequently if you operate the machine in dusty conditions.
The carburetor plays a vital role in mixing air and fuel for combustion. A dirty or clogged carburetor can disrupt this process, leading to hard starts or no starts at all. Here’s how to inspect and clean it:
Check for blockages or residue in the carburetor, especially if the machine has been sitting unused
Remove the air filter to access the carburetor. Look for signs of residue, gum, or varnish caused by stale fuel. These deposits can block the jets and prevent fuel from reaching the engine.
Adjust or clean the carburetor to ensure proper fuel flow
Use a carburetor cleaner spray to remove debris and residue. For severe clogs, disassemble the carburetor and soak it in a cleaning solution. Rebuild it with new gaskets if necessary. Adjust the carburetor settings according to the manual to optimize fuel flow and engine performance.
Pro Tip: If your machine has been idle for an extended period, always inspect the carburetor before attempting to start it. Stale fuel can cause significant blockages that hinder performance.

When your grass cutting machine refuses to start, electrical system issues might be the culprit. Addressing these problems ensures the engine receives the spark and power it needs to function properly. Follow these steps to troubleshoot the electrical components effectively.
The spark plug ignition system plays a critical role in starting your machine. A faulty spark plug or ignition coil can prevent the engine from firing. Here’s how you can test and resolve these issues:
Use a spark tester to confirm the spark plug is firing correctly
Attach a spark tester to the spark plug and crank the engine. Observe the tester for a visible spark. A strong, consistent spark indicates the ignition system is functioning properly. If no spark appears, the problem lies within the ignition system.
Replace the ignition coil if there’s no spark
When the spark tester shows no spark, inspect the ignition coil. A damaged or worn-out coil fails to generate the voltage needed for ignition. Replace the coil with a compatible one as specified in the manual. This step restores the spark and ensures the engine starts smoothly.
Expert Tip: According to Briggs & Stratton, worn or dirty spark plugs require more voltage to produce a spark. Regularly inspect and replace spark plugs to avoid unnecessary strain on the ignition system.
For electric or battery-operated models, wiring and battery health are essential for proper operation. Faulty connections or a weak battery can disrupt the starting process. Take these steps to inspect and fix these components:
Look for loose, frayed, or disconnected wires
Examine the wiring harness for any visible damage. Loose or frayed wires interrupt the electrical flow, preventing the machine from starting. Reconnect any loose wires and replace damaged ones to restore proper connectivity.
Verify that the battery is charged and the terminals are clean and securely connected
Check the battery voltage using a multimeter. A fully charged battery ensures the motor receives adequate power. Clean the terminals with a wire brush to remove corrosion. Securely tighten the connections to prevent power loss during startup.
Pro Tip: Always disconnect the battery before cleaning the terminals to avoid accidental short circuits. Regular maintenance of the battery and wiring keeps your machine reliable.

Mechanical problems can often prevent your grass cutting machine from starting. Addressing these issues ensures the machine operates smoothly and efficiently. Follow these steps to resolve common mechanical challenges.
The blade area can accumulate debris, which may hinder the engine’s ability to start. Clearing these obstructions is essential for proper operation.
Turn off the machine and inspect the blade area for debris or blockages
Always ensure the machine is powered off and cooled down before inspecting the blade. Look for grass clippings, twigs, or other debris that might be stuck under the cutting deck. These obstructions can create drag on the motor, making it difficult to start.
Clear any obstructions carefully to avoid damage
Use a stick or tool to remove debris instead of your hands to avoid injury. Be thorough in clearing the area to ensure the blade can rotate freely. Regularly checking for obstructions prevents long-term damage to the motor and blade assembly.
Tip: After every mowing session, inspect the blade area to keep your machine in optimal condition. This simple habit can save you from startup troubles in the future.
The starter rope plays a crucial role in turning over the engine. A stuck or damaged rope can make starting the machine nearly impossible. Addressing this issue promptly ensures smooth operation.
Ensure the starter rope is not stuck or frayed
Pull the rope gently to check if it moves freely. If the rope only extends a few inches or jams midway, the spring mechanism may not be tightening enough to turn over the motor. Dirt or debris in the recoil housing can also cause the rope to stick.
Replace the starter rope if it’s damaged or difficult to pull
Examine the rope for signs of wear, such as fraying or tearing. Replace it with a new one if necessary. A fresh starter rope ensures consistent performance and reduces strain on the recoil mechanism.
Pro Tip: Many causes of a stuck pull cord can be fixed with a DIY approach. Cleaning the recoil housing or replacing the rope are straightforward tasks that restore functionality.

To fix a hydro-locked mower, start by identifying the affected part. Remove the spark plug and inspect it for dampness. If the spark plug is wet, it indicates that fuel or oil has entered the combustion chamber. Drain the excess liquid by tilting the mower carefully and allowing it to flow out. Once drained, clean or replace the spark plug before attempting to restart the mower.

When the choke plate doesn’t close fully, it can hinder the engine’s ability to start. Engage the choke and observe the plate’s movement. If it doesn’t close completely, adjust it according to the manufacturer’s instructions. Ensuring the choke plate functions correctly improves the engine’s performance during startup.
